RNase L ligand 2
RNase L ligand 2 (compound 6) is the Rnase L ligand part of RNAse L RIBOTAC (HY-168455), an RNA-degrading chimera which binds to a four-way RNA helix called SL5 in the 5’ UTR of the SARS-CoV-2 RNA genome and inhibits the virus replication in lung epithelial carcinoma cells. RNase L ligand 2 can be used in the synthesis of RIBOTAC[1].
